: 2. Under the stipulation that God is perfect, why was she unable to maintain a handstand? Sorry, it bugged me?

She was in human form. Besides she was doing handstands for her own entertainment, so probably the human struggle of it was part of the pleasure.

: 3. Is there any way you could pull a Tarantino and release an uncut version of this film. I am one of the many who felt it was slightly... rushed.

Kevin and Vincent have both said that they intend to release both the theatrical version (although this might be *slightly* beefed up) and the rough cut on the DVD edition. I look forward to this and hope they are able to arrange this with the DVD distributor, etc.
